Sarah wrote:
Hi! I’m doing size medium of the hat! I finished the ribbing part of the pattern and I’m just confused on how to evenly space the decreases? I did 116 decided by 20 and I got 5.8…. How do you suggest I evenly space it-? Also, looking at the pattern, it says instructions on the decrease tip. So what exactly do I do for the decreases? Knit 2 together? Or ssk?
17.11.2025 - 22:10DROPS Design answered:
Hi Sarah, If you get a number like 5.8 when you have divided the number of stitches by the number of decreases, you decrease every after 6th stitch x 4, then after the 5th stitch, after every 6th stitch x 4, after the 5th stitch etc.. To work these decreases it is neatest to knit 2 together. The decrease tip is for decreasing either side of the markers later on. Regards, Drops Team.

Please can you explain what decrease you must make after the ribbing? It says 'Knit 1 round and decrease 19-20-18 stitches evenly spaced = 93-96-102 stitches.' how do you do that, please?
26.06.2025 - 00:18DROPS Design answered:
Hi Sylvie, You divide the number of stitches on the round with the number of decreases (e.g., 112/19 in size S = 5.9). To decrease knit 2 together after approx. every 6th stitch on the round. Regards, Drops Team.

Knitted hat in DROPS Lima and DROPS Kid-Silk. The piece is worked bottom up.
DROPS 242-48 |
|
|
------------------------------------------------------- EXPLANATIONS FOR THE PATTERN: ------------------------------------------------------- DECREASE TIP: Work until there are 3 stitches left before the marker-thread, knit 2 together, knit 2 (marker-thread sits between these stitches), slip 1 stitch, knit 1 and pass the slipped stitch over the knitted stitch. Repeat at each marker-thread = 6 stitches decreased on the round. ------------------------------------------------------- START THE PIECE HERE: ------------------------------------------------------- HAT - SHORT OVERVIEW OF THE PIECE: The piece is worked in the round on circular needle, bottom up. Change to double pointed needles when necessary. HAT: Cast on 112-116-120 stitches with circular needle size 3 mm, 1 strand DROPS Lima and 1 strand DROPS Kid-Silk (= 2 strands). Purl 1 round, then work rib in the round (knit 2, purl 2) for 12 cm. Knit 1 round and decrease 19-20-18 stitches evenly spaced = 93-96-102 stitches. Change to circular needle size 4 mm. Work stocking stitch. REMEMBER THE KNITTING TENSION! When the piece measures 22-23-23 cm, insert 3 marker-threads with 31-32-34 stitches between each one. Decrease every 2nd round - read DECREASE TIP 11-11-12 times = 27-30-30 stitches, then every round 1 time = 21-24-24 stitches. Knit 1-0-0, then knit 2 and 2 stitches together on the whole round = 11-12-12 stitches. Cut the strand, pull it through the remaining stitches, tighten and fasten well Fold the bottom edge up to the right side (approx. 8 cm of 12 cm rib is folded). The hat measures approx. 23-24-25 cm when folded up. |
